
The White House is preparing to order US agencies to partner with AI companies on cybersecurity, which will significantly impact the enterprise infrastructure of these agencies. Consequently, this move is expected to enhance the operational scalability of their cybersecurity systems. The executive order would allow AI companies to work closely with government agencies without requiring pre-release model testing, potentially leading to market disruption in the cybersecurity industry.
